Most climbers underestimate how much time acclimatization actually takes, and most itineraries sold online underestimate it too. A realistic acclimatization schedule isn't about ticking off a fixed number of days — it's about giving your body the repeated exposure it needs to adjust, at a pace it can actually handle.
Rushing this stage is the single most common reason strong, fit climbers fail to summit, or worse, need to be evacuated.
A few things every climber should understand before booking:
"Climb high, sleep low" isn't a slogan, it's the whole method. The core principle of acclimatization is ascending to a higher altitude during the day and returning to sleep at a lower one. This is what actually trains your body to adapt, far more than simply spending nights at increasing altitudes. A schedule that skips this rotation to save days is skipping the part that actually works.
Rest days are not wasted days. Many climbers see a scheduled rest day and feel they're losing progress. In reality, this is when your body is doing the adaptation work. Cutting a rest day to keep to a tighter itinerary is one of the most common — and most preventable — mistakes I see.
Your fitness level does not predict how you'll acclimatize. This surprises a lot of strong climbers. Altitude sickness has little to do with cardiovascular fitness and a lot to do with individual physiology and how strictly the ascent rate is followed. I've guided very fit climbers who struggled and less conventionally fit climbers who acclimatized well, simply because they respected the pace.
A realistic schedule allows buffer days, not just climbing days. Weather delays, individual pacing differences, and unexpected symptoms all need room in the itinerary. A schedule with zero flexibility built in is a schedule that pressures people to push through symptoms they shouldn't ignore.
A few practical notes: watch for early symptoms — headache, loss of appetite, or disturbed sleep — and treat them as information, not an inconvenience to push through. Staying properly hydrated and avoiding alcohol during the ascent phase makes a measurable difference. And above roughly 3,000m, most well-designed schedules limit net altitude gain per sleeping night to a few hundred meters, with periodic extra nights built in as elevation increases — your guide should be able to explain exactly why the schedule is shaped the way it is, not just tell you to follow it.
